What Makes a Great Assassin Name?

When crafting an assassin name, several key elements come into play. A great name should be memorable, evoke a sense of mystery, and reflect the character's traits or history. Here are some aspects to consider:

  • Sound: The phonetics should be catchy and easy to remember.
  • Meaning: Names can convey specific traits or backgrounds.
  • Imagery: The name should evoke visual elements associated with stealth and secrecy.
  • Originality: Unique names stand out and create a lasting impression.

What are Some Popular Male Assassin Names in Fiction?

Fictional assassins have become staples in literature, film, and video games. Here are some well-known male assassin names that have captivated audiences:

  • Ezio Auditore: The charismatic protagonist from the Assassin's Creed series.
  • Agent 47: The infamous hitman from the Hitman video game franchise.
  • John Wick: A legendary assassin with a reputation for vengeance.
  • Altair Ibn-La'Ahad: A master assassin from the original Assassin's Creed.

Can You Create a Unique Male Assassin Name?

Creating a unique male assassin name can be a fun and creative process. Here are some tips to help you brainstorm:

  1. Combine Words: Merge two evocative words to create a name (e.g., "Night" and "Blade" ="Nightblade").
  2. Use Foreign Languages: Look for words in other languages that mean stealth, shadow, or death.
  3. Incorporate Nature: Use elements from nature that suggest darkness or danger (e.g., "Raven," "Wolf").
  4. Consider Historical Context: Research historical names or their meanings to find inspiration.

What Are Some Examples of Unique Male Assassin Names?

Here are some unique male assassin names to spark your creativity:

  • Shade: A name that evokes stealth and secrecy.
  • Viper: Suggestive of a dangerous, swift killer.
  • Rook: Inspired by the chess piece, symbolizing strategy and cunning.
  • Falcon: A name associated with keen eyesight and precision.

How Do Male Assassin Names Reflect Character Traits?

The names assigned to male assassins often reflect their character traits, skills, or motivations. For example, a character named "Ghost" might be stealthy and elusive, capable of disappearing without a trace. In contrast, a name like "Rage" could suggest a more aggressive style, focusing on brute force rather than subtlety. Understanding the link between a name and the character's personality can enhance storytelling and character development.
